Research :Narrative In Music Video

In the majority of music videos they follow a narrative structure. As part of our research, we have been looking at real media examples, which are in the music charts which follow a narrative structure. One of these videos is One Direction - What Makes You Beautiful.


Plot/Narrative:

-       All five of the boys enter the beach with their friends having a good time, alone.
-       On holiday together
-       A group of girls are alone in their cars, going on holiday to the same place as the boys.
-       They all meet up, and go to the beach together (having fun in the sand/sea)
-       Harry confronts a girl, and sings to her, telling her what he thinks of her.
-       Disruption of the video – girls arriving in their beetle car.

Theories:

-       Todorov: equilibrium then disruption and finally re-equilibrium
The equilibrium in the music video is One Direction on holiday with their friends (which are all boys) on the beach having fun. Then suddenly there is a disruption which is the girls turning up and ruining the boy get-together. Finally the re-equilibrium is the boys and girls getting together, at a campfire.

-       Levi- Strauss: this is when there is conflict in the media text
This theory is not used in this video, as they all get along and there is no conflict.
